2. What the app does, and does not do

Vespr Charge lets you start and stop charging sessions at electric vehicle charge points that you have been granted access to, and see information about those sessions.

The app is not a public charging network. You can only use charge points that an operator — an employer, landlord, fleet operator or installer — has given you access to. We do not provide charge points, we do not supply electricity, and we do not control whether a charge point is available.

4. Using charge points safely

You are responsible for using charging equipment safely and in line with the manufacturer’s instructions and any rules set by the site owner.

You must not use the app to start a charging session unless your vehicle is correctly connected and it is safe to charge.

Do not use the app while driving.

If a charge point appears damaged, is overheating, or a cable is damaged, do not use it. Report it to your operator using the Support option in the app.

The “release cable” function unlocks a connector. Only use it when it is safe to remove the cable. Do not use it to interrupt a charging session in an emergency — in an emergency, use the charge point’s own emergency stop or isolate the supply.

5. Charging costs

Whether you pay for charging, and how much, is a matter between you and your operator. Vespr does not set those prices.

Where the app shows a cost, it is an estimate based on information provided by your operator and the energy recorded by the charge point. It is not an invoice and may differ from what you are actually billed.

7. Smart charging

Where your operator has enabled smart charging, sessions may be scheduled to run at particular times, for example to use cheaper off-peak electricity.

You can always override a schedule and charge immediately by starting a session in the app. Doing so may mean you pay a higher rate for that energy.

Charge points may also apply electrical limits set for the safety of the site’s supply. These limits are not overridable, and are separate from any time-based schedule.
